TL;DR Summary

Photographer and artist John Kelly has created a series of AI-generated images titled "Boring America Photorealism" that depict unremarkable scenes resembling basic phone photos. Kelly used the AI tool Midjourney and specific prompts to achieve a casual and unfiltered look. The images, which aim to capture an eerie sense of humanity, have gone viral on Reddit, receiving 12,000 upvotes. While some users praised the convincing vibe, others critiqued the flaws and debated the nature of AI art. Kelly believes the attention his work has received highlights the rapid development of AI art tools and suggests a potential shift in our perception of reality.
